Prince Harry and Meghan Markle’s Latest Statement Branded ‘Spiteful’ Amid Royal Tensions

Prince Harry and Meghan Markle have sparked fresh criticism after their latest public statement was described as “spiteful” and directed at the wider Royal Family, according to coverage from The Express. The controversy follows a formal message issued through the couple’s representatives, which commentators argue reignited tensions rather than easing them.

The newspaper reports that the tone and timing of the Sussexes’ statement were perceived by royal observers as a direct challenge to Buckingham Palace’s efforts to maintain stability and consistency in public messaging. Analysts quoted in the coverage suggested the couple’s wording appeared aimed at distancing themselves further from the institution while still inserting themselves into major royal narratives.

The reaction reflects an ongoing pattern in British media: any communication from the Sussexes is now evaluated not just for content but for its political and familial implications. As recent reporting in The Guardian has noted, Buckingham Palace remains cautious about responding to the couple’s independent statements, often opting not to comment at all in order to avoid further escalation.

Supporters of Harry and Meghan online argued that the couple were simply asserting their independence and right to express themselves, but critics maintain the statement’s tone could further damage already-strained relationships. With key royal events approaching in 2025, the divide between the Sussexes and the rest of the Royal Family appears no closer to resolution.
